Atiku Abubakar, the presidential candidate of the African Democratic Congress (ADC), has reaffirmed his commitment to restoring the petrol subsidy if elected in 2027, contradicting a statement from one of his media aides who suggested the subsidy would be phased out. Atiku's stance indicates a clear policy direction on fuel pricing. The clarification comes amid ongoing debates about subsidy removal in Nigeria. His position is expected to influence his campaign strategy.
